BioShock Infinite: Burial at Sea Trailer Shows Us Rapture is Real

The first BioShock Infinite: Burial at Sea DLC teaser trailer has been released, and it’s far different from any teaser trailer we’ve seen before.

Taking the form of an old “Fact from Myth” segment, the narrator explains the story of Rapture, which was believed to be fictional until a trunk of artifacts belonging to the underwater city washed up on the New England coast. The trailer then cuts to a woman who was allegedly a resident of Rapture being questioned about the artifacts, specifically a picture of Elizabeth, who is not best pleased about being confronted with the image.
